The full picture

Nika Pharmaceuticals is a small drug company focused on developing medicines, likely in the specialty or generic pharmaceutical space. It works on creating or improving drugs that treat specific medical conditions, selling to hospitals, pharmacies, or other healthcare providers. The company operates in the broader pharmaceutical industry, where getting a drug approved by regulators like the FDA is the central challenge.

The company appears to be in an early or development stage, as its gross and operating margins are both at zero percent, meaning it is not yet generating meaningful profit from sales. Despite this, its reported ROIC of 24.7% suggests some capital efficiency, though this figure may reflect limited asset base rather than mature operations. The biggest risk for a company this size is the high cost and uncertainty of drug development — clinical trials can fail, and regulatory approval is never guaranteed, which makes the path to sustainable revenue difficult.
